Over the summer of 2021, I turned 40 – a milestone. That big BIRTHDAY! 

I could feel something stirring inside me. A knowing that things are about to shake up this decade. An end to playing it safe, and time to embark on a new horizon.  Inner growth and an anticipation for a new phase of life.  

Prior to turning 40, a few of my girlfriends offered their sentiments.  It was articulated, that 40 would  bring some unrest.  There will be soul-searching, questioning my life path and who I AM. 

I thought to myself, “I do this daily”.  Truth be told, turning 40 was not an simple process. I hesitated, as to whether I wanted to share my experience.  After a peaceful meditation, the decision was clear. I wanted to share my story.  It is being honest with ourselves, that helps one heal and assist others.  Maybe this is what was meant all along?

My 40th was spent with family.  This filled my heart with such compassion and love. I could not have asked for a better celebration.  Being in the company of family is all one needs to feel cherished. I had every type of Italian dessert you could imagine and was surrounded by love.  Phone calls from family and friends lifted the spirit.  

On the opposite side of the pendulum, I kept thinking where have the last 40  years of my life gone?  I wanted to avoid my emotions and was in denial.  I felt inadequate, unworthiness crept in.  My choices, decisions and past were all flooding forward. 

I thought by 40, I would have my life together.  What does having together really mean anyway?  I had to allow this to surface.  Release all preconceived notions and judgments.  There was a long list and I was tormenting myself.  I needed to embrace all contrasting emotions to find clarity. This was a turning point.  There were plenty of tears, ice-cream and journaling.

Spiritually speaking, I was being governed by my ego.  Sitting in regret and unkind to my heart.  It took an enlightening conversation with my younger brother to break the funk.  I was thankful for his insight.  He offered words of guidance that allowed me to soften.
